    tribe found in various parts of South and Southeast Asia. They are a tribe of the larger ethnic group which the Britishers called them as Chin in Myanmar and Kuki in Manipur and Lushai(now Mizo) in Mizoram‚ but it is notable that‚ European writer‚ Sir J. George Scott claimed in his book Handbook of Practical Information 1911 & Burma and Beyond 1932 that‚ the Zomi never called themselves by such names as Kuki or Chin or Lushai.
